punch-bowl

Date: 1771-1772

Media: silver gilt

Size: h(cm) : 27 x diam(cm) : 41 x h(in) : 10 5/8

Acquired: 1967; Purchased with the assistance of the Art Fund

Accession Number: NMW A 50455

This punch bowl was the first and most important piece of silver that Robert Adam designed for Sir Watkin Williams-Wynn. It was commissioned to celebrate the success of Sir Watkin's horse Fop at the Chester Races. Described as 'a Superbe punch Bowl very highly finish’d in an Antique Taste’ it cost £185 – the equivalent of a good professional salary today.
